CVE-2018-1494 : Exploit Details and Defense Strategies

Learn about CVE-2018-1494 affecting IBM DOORS Next Generation versions 5.0-5.0.2 and 6.0-6.0.5. Discover the impact, technical details, and mitigation steps for this cross-site scripting vulnerability.

IBM DOORS Next Generation (DNG/RRC) versions 5.0 through 5.0.2 and 6.0 through 6.0.5 are vulnerable to cross-site scripting, potentially leading to credential disclosure. This vulnerability allows users to insert JavaScript code into the Web UI, affecting functionality.

Understanding CVE-2018-1494

This CVE involves a vulnerability in IBM DOORS Next Generation (DNG/RRC) that exposes systems to cross-site scripting attacks.

What is CVE-2018-1494?

The versions 5.0 through 5.0.2 and 6.0 through 6.0.5 of IBM DOORS Next Generation have a vulnerability that enables users to inject JavaScript code into the Web UI. This can alter the expected functionality and may lead to credential exposure during trusted sessions.

The Impact of CVE-2018-1494

The vulnerability poses a medium severity risk with a CVSS base score of 5.4. It requires user interaction for exploitation and has a confirmed exploit code available.

Technical Details of CVE-2018-1494

This section provides detailed technical information about the vulnerability.

Vulnerability Description

The vulnerability in IBM DOORS Next Generation allows for cross-site scripting, enabling the insertion of arbitrary JavaScript code into the Web UI.

Affected Systems and Versions

        Rational DOORS Next Generation 5.0.2
        Rational DOORS Next Generation 5.0
        Rational DOORS Next Generation 5.0.1
        Rational DOORS Next Generation 6.0
        Rational DOORS Next Generation 6.0.1
        Rational DOORS Next Generation 6.0.2
        Rational DOORS Next Generation 6.0.3
        Rational DOORS Next Generation 6.0.4
        Rational DOORS Next Generation 6.0.5

Exploitation Mechanism

The vulnerability requires low privileges and user interaction to exploit, with a high exploit code maturity level.
